    linNet

    linNet

    The Software for symbolic Analysis of linear Electronic Circuits

    linNet is an application to compute the transfer function of linear, electronic circuits. The computation is done symbolically, not numerically, and the result is a formula rather than a number or a series of such. The found formula is the Laplace transform of the dependencies of the voltages and currents in the circuit on the input voltages and currents. A linear electronic circuit is a combination of the supported basic devices; these are resistor, conductance, capacitor, inductivity, operational amplifier, voltage source (constant or controlled by another voltage or current), current source (constant or controlled by voltage or another current) or a current probe (i.e. a wire). ...

    XFUNC22
    ...Accept resistors, capacitors, inductors, dependent sources, ideal opamps, and ideal switches. Component values can be real numbers, symbols, or user defined symbolic expressions. Frequency domain results can be transformed to time domain via Inverse Laplace or Z Transform. Transformation between S-domain and Z-domain results can be done via Forward or Backward Derivatives (Euler Transform), Bilinear, or Impulse Invariant Transforms. Provide Bode, Gain-Phase, Nyquist, Pole-zero, Impulse, and Step response plots. Plot ranges can be set manually or automatically.
